What is Strawberry Cinnamon Rolls
Strawberry cinnamon rolls are soft, yeasted sweet rolls filled with fresh strawberries, cream cheese, cinnamon, and sugar, then rolled up and baked until golden with sweet glaze drizzled on top. Unlike traditional cinnamon rolls that rely solely on cinnamon-sugar filling, these feature fresh strawberries that create beautiful pink swirls and bursts of fruity flavor in every bite. The result combines the comfort of classic cinnamon rolls with bright strawberry taste and cream cheese richness.
How To Make Strawberry Cinnamon Rolls
Most strawberry cinnamon roll recipes have strawberries that make the dough soggy or lose their flavor among other ingredients. Our method uses fresh diced strawberries mixed with cornstarch to prevent excess moisture, plus cream cheese that adds richness while enhancing strawberry flavor. The secret is cooking the strawberries briefly to concentrate flavor and remove moisture, then letting the dough rise properly so it stays light and fluffy even with fruit filling.
Strawberry Cinnamon Rolls Ingredients
For the Soft Yeast Dough:
- 3 ½ cups all-purpose flour
- ¼ cup granulated sugar
- 1 packet (2 ¼ tsp) active dry yeast
- 1 teaspoon salt
- ½ cup warm milk (110°F)
- ¼ cup butter, melted
- 1 large egg
For the Strawberry Cream Cheese Filling:
- 8 oz cream cheese, softened
- ⅓ cup granulated sugar
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 ½ cups fresh strawberries, diced small
- 2 tablespoons cornstarch
- 2 tablespoons brown sugar
- 1 teaspoon cinnamon
For the Sweet Glaze:
- 1 ½ cups powdered sugar
- 3-4 tablespoons milk
- ½ teaspoon vanilla extract
- Pink food coloring (optional)
Max's Step by Step Method
Create Perfect Yeast Dough
- In large bowl, combine warm milk, sugar, and yeast; let sit 5 minutes until foamy
- Add melted butter, egg, salt, and 2 cups flour; mix until combined
- Gradually add remaining flour until soft dough forms that's slightly sticky
- Knead on floured surface 8-10 minutes until smooth and elastic, then rise 1 hour
Prepare Strawberry Cream Cheese Magic
- While dough rises, mix diced strawberries with cornstarch and brown sugar
- Cook strawberry mixture in small pan 3-4 minutes until slightly thickened, then cool
- In separate bowl, beat softened cream cheese with sugar, vanilla, and cinnamon until smooth
- Gently fold cooled strawberry mixture into cream cheese for swirled filling
Roll and Fill with Beautiful Swirls
- Roll risen dough into 12x18 inch rectangle on floured surface
- Spread cream cheese-strawberry mixture evenly, leaving 1-inch border on long side
- Roll up tightly from long side and seal seam, then cut into 12 equal rolls
- Place rolls in greased 9x13 pan, cover, and rise 45 minutes until puffy
Bake and Glaze to Perfection
- Preheat oven to 350°F and bake rolls 25-30 minutes until golden brown
- While baking, whisk together powdered sugar, milk, vanilla, and food coloring for glaze
- Cool rolls 10 minutes, then drizzle with glaze while still warm
- Serve immediately for the most gooey, beautiful presentation with visible strawberry swirls

Strawberry Cinnamon Rolls Variations
Strawberry Shortcake Version:
- Add 2 tablespoons heavy cream to the cream cheese mixture
- Top finished rolls with fresh whipped cream and extra strawberry pieces
- Creates that classic strawberry shortcake flavor in cinnamon roll form
- Perfect for summer gatherings or special occasions
Chocolate Strawberry Indulgence:
- Add 2 tablespoons cocoa powder to the cream cheese filling
- Drizzle with both vanilla glaze and melted chocolate
- Creates a chocolate-covered strawberry flavor combination
- Great for those who want something extra decadent
Lemon Strawberry Bright:
- Add lemon zest to both the filling and the glaze
- Include 1 tablespoon lemon juice in the cream cheese mixture
- Creates a bright, summery flavor that enhances the strawberries
- Perfect for spring and summer entertaining
Make-Ahead Overnight Version:
- Prepare rolls completely through cutting and placing in pan
- Cover and refrigerate overnight, then let come to room temperature 1 hour
- Rise and bake as directed for fresh morning rolls
- Perfect for special occasion breakfasts without early morning work

Storage Tips
Best Fresh
Serve warm within 2 hours of baking for the most gooey texture and optimal strawberry flavor. Fresh rolls have the perfect contrast between soft bread and creamy filling.
Leftover Storage
- Store covered at room temperature up to 2 days
- Reheat individual rolls in microwave 15-20 seconds to restore warmth
- Refrigerate for longer storage up to 5 days, bring to room temperature before serving
Make-Ahead Options
- Prepare through rising stage and refrigerate overnight before baking
- Freeze unbaked rolls up to 1 month, thaw overnight and bake as directed
- Baked rolls freeze well up to 2 months, thaw and reheat gently
Tips for Top Strawberry Cinnamon Rolls
My great-grandmother's handwritten recipe book taught me the key to perfect strawberry cinnamon rolls: "Cook those berries first, Hannah; raw fruit makes soggy bottoms and nobody wants that!" Her wisdom was spot-on; briefly cooking strawberries with cornstarch removes excess moisture while concentrating flavor. She also emphasized proper rising time: "Patience makes prettier rolls, and prettier rolls make people think you're a better baker than you are." Her final tip about cream cheese temperature was crucial: it needs to be soft enough to spread easily but not so warm that it melts into the strawberries and loses that beautiful swirled effect.
Frequently Asked Questions
What are dirty strawberry cinnamon rolls?
"dirty" strawberry cinnamon rolls typically refers to one with extra gooey filling or unconventional add-ins. Our strawberry version could be considered "dirty" because of the rich cream cheese and fruit filling that makes it extra indulgent.
Do cinnamon and strawberry go together?
Absolutely! Cinnamon and strawberry is a classic combination; the warm spice enhances the sweetness of strawberries while adding depth of flavor that prevents the fruit from being too one-dimensional.
What does pouring heavy cream on cinnamon rolls do?
Heavy cream poured over cinnamon rolls before baking creates an incredibly rich, custardy texture and helps keep the rolls moist during baking, resulting in extra gooey centers.
What is the secret to fluffy strawberry cinnamon rolls?
The key is proper yeast activation, adequate rising time, not adding too much flour during kneading, and baking at the right temperature. Room temperature ingredients also help create tender, fluffy texture.
